- W2534195004 abstract "In his near quarter century on the Court, Justice Clarence Thomas has written extensively on significant issues such as equal protection, religion, and federalism. But in the Court’s spring 2015 term, Thomas for the first time wrote substantively on the constitutional separation of powers. For Thomas, the Constitution understood government to possess three distinct types of power—legislative, executive, and judicial—and then constructed the three branches to each exercise its vested power type. I consider how Thomas defined the three powers, as well as how he saw the Constitution creating each branch with the qualities needed to exercise the power given it. All along, I show how Thomas connected separation of powers to the Constitution’s larger goal: protecting individual liberty. I then conclude with limitations to Thomas’s view and how it, while not achieving total victory, may aid in increasing the Court’s fidelity to constitutional norms." @default.
